FID-007 and Cetuximab in Treating Patients With Advanced Head and Neck Squamous Cell Carcinoma
NCT06332092 · Status: ACTIVE_NOT_RECRUITING · Phase: PHASE2 · Type: INTERVENTIONAL · Enrollment: 46
Last updated 2026-03-16
Summary
The goal of this FID-007 Clinical Trial is to compare the efficacy of different dosing regimens of FID-007 in combination with Cetuximab in patients with recurrent or metastatic Head and Neck Squamous Cell Carcinoma (HNSCC). The main questions it aims to answer are: to evaluate the efficacy, and to characterize the safety and tolerability. Eligible participants will be enrolled and randomized to 1 of 2 arms of FID-007 with fixed-dose Cetuximab in each 28-day cycle.

FID007
Patients will receive FID007 via IV infusion at their assigned dose on Days 1, 8, and 15 of each 28-day cycle. Starting from Cycle 2, Cetuximab will be administered every 2 weeks on Days 1 and 15 of each 28-day cycle.
